Injuries can derail the season for even the most promising of Super Bowl contenders. And although the Carolina Panthers were never that to begin with here in 2026, they've been hammered by injuries at training camp thus far—putting a bit of a damper on our expectations for the upcoming season.

What hurts most about the string of bad injury news is that it's hit every premium position. At the moment, their two starting offensive tackles are out indefinitely, they've lost their second-best edge rusher for the year and a key piece at wide receiver and, heck, even their third-string quarterback has been sidelined after an exciting Hall of Fame Game performance.

But while the starting lineup looks a little different now, these losses can afford new opportunities for guys further down the depth chart. One of them may be free-agent pickup John Metchie III, who had a strong preseason debut.

In their 2026 preview of the Panthers, Pro Football Focus has identified Metchie as a contender for the No. 3 spot that is supposed to go to either Xavier Legette or David Moore. Analyst Gordon McGuinness writes:

Through two NFL seasons, Legette has been outproduced by Jalen Coker, who went undrafted in the same class, and [Chris] Brazzell was set to provide another challenger for playing time. An early training camp injury is expected to cost Brazzell his rookie season, however, shifting the focus to whether John Metchie can push Legette for a starting role. Metchie has shown occasional flashes through his first three NFL seasons, but his career average of 1.03 yards per route run suggests he presents a less significant threat to Legette's role than Brazzell might have.

If Legette looks like a completely different player at camp and can prove it during the preseason, then we'd have no objection to him starting the year in the WR3 role. It would be a mistake to gift that spot to Moore, no matter how great of a practice player he supposedly may be.

Metchie, despite just joining the team in the spring, already has a history (and a pretty good one, at that) with starting quarterback Bryce Young. At the University of Alabama in 2021, during Young's Heisman Trophy-winning campaign, Metchie posted 96 catches for 1,142 yards and eight touchdowns.

This may end up as the most intriguing battle for the Panthers over the last few weeks of the preseason, especially if dark horse emerges.
